		<title>FontStruct is a free online truetype font-building tool.</title>
		<link>http://www.metafilter.com/70776/FontStruct%2Dis%2Da%2Dfree%2Donline%2Dtruetype%2Dfontbuilding%2Dtool</link>
		<description>&lt;a href="http://fontstruct.fontshop.com/"&gt;FontStruct&lt;/a&gt; &lt;em&gt;lets you quickly and easily create fonts constructed out of geometrical shapes, which are arranged in a grid pattern, like tiles or bricks. Once you&apos;re done building, FontStruct generates high-quality TrueType fonts, ready to use in any Mac or Windows application.&lt;/em&gt;  </description>

		<title>Helvetica: The Apotheosis of the Invisible Art</title>
		<link>http://www.metafilter.com/60487/Helvetica%2DThe%2DApotheosis%2Dof%2Dthe%2DInvisible%2DArt</link>
		<description> In 1957, Swiss typographer &lt;a href=&quot;http://cis1.western.tec.wi.us/halee/type/the_man.html &quot;&gt;Max Miedinger&lt;/a&gt; invented &quot;&lt;a href=&quot;http://www.thestar.com/sciencetech/article/203181&quot;&gt;the official typeface of the 20th century&lt;/a&gt;&quot; -- &lt;a href=&quot;http://www.bnind.com/products/iconic/Helvetica.asp&quot;&gt;Helvetica&lt;/a&gt; [previously discussed &lt;a href=&quot;http://www.metafilter.com/29975/Once-there-was-a-typeface-called-Helvetica&quot;&gt;here&lt;/a&gt;, via &lt;a href=&quot;http://www.aldaily.com/&quot;&gt;Arts and Letters Daily&lt;/a&gt;].  </description>
